I assume you mean by level 10 as in just recently starting the game/account.
My advice is do a standard clear, don't go for the raptor start clear I do on my streams as you lose a lot of hp, and tend not to get a good pull. Start buffs first, and go refillable potion, if you're struggling and are forced to back, start 3 potions instead.
Early game strat > farm till 6, if you see free kills take them with
Mid game, take objectives such as dragons, towers etc. Try to set up dives to get free objectives, but obviously ensure it's possible to kill them without dying yourself. Try to group with team if ahead, if not split.
Late game try and get a pick, and then group to make the fight 5v4. If they constantly group, split push but try to not give baron away. Make sure you ward, and know where enemies are before committing to a split, if they try to baron, try and at least get an inhibitor to trade.
